WebThe Russian Civil War was a civil war fought from 7 November 1917 to 16 June 1922 between several groups in Russia.The main fighting was between the Red Army and the White Army.The Red Army was a communist, Bolshevik group. The White Army was Anti-Communist and included many former Tsar Loyalists. WebThe Red Army won the Russian Civil War because their army was better organized, united and disciplined towards a single end – winning the war. The Red Army used foreign intervention as a rallying point, and held the best territory – controlling the center of Russia. The Red Army used terror tactics as well.
